Thousands of homes in flood-hit areas are getting running water again but it will be at least two weeks before it is drinkable, the Environment Agency said yesterday.
Some 140,000 homes across Gloucestershire were cut off from the water supply after the Mythe treatment plant, near Tewkesbury, was flooded. Tim Brain, Chief Constable of Gloucestershire, said that the recovery operation was moving steadily. “There is light at the end of the tunnel,” he said. “The restoration of supply is beginning very slowly and cautiously, and appropriately so, because we don’t want any mishaps at this stage.”
Victims of the flooding yesterday attacked five-figure bonuses awarded to Environment Agency executives. Baroness Young of Old Scone, the agency’s chief executive, received a bonus of £24,000 on top of her salary of £163,000. Lady Young said last week that water bills would have to rise to cover the cost of flooding.
It also emerged that the agency expressed concern in September that many authorities’ flood evacuation procedures were inadequate.
